Why Rear View Systems Matter More Than You Think

Let's start with the basics: trucks are big. Really big. A standard semi-truck can have a blind spot the size of a small car directly behind it, and that's before you factor in side blind spots, low-light conditions, or inclement weather. For drivers, this means maneuvering in parking lots, backing up to loading docks, or navigating residential areas becomes a high-stakes balancing act. Even the most experienced drivers can miss a pedestrian, a cyclist, or a stationary object when visibility is poor. That's where a robust rear view camera system steps in. It's not just a "nice-to-have"—it's a tool that turns a truck's blind spots into clear, real-time visuals, giving drivers the confidence to make split-second decisions safely.

Quality That Stands Up to the Road

Trucks don't take days off, and neither should their rear view systems. That's why every product we source is rigorously tested for durability, performance, and reliability. Let's break down the specs that matter most—and why they're non-negotiable:

Waterproofing (IP Ratings): We only stock cameras with IP67 or higher ratings. IP67 means the camera can be submerged in up to 1 meter of water for 30 minutes; IP68 can handle deeper submersion, and IP69K (like our heavy-duty backup camera) is built for high-pressure, high-temperature washes. For truckers who regularly clean their vehicles or drive in rainy climates, this isn't optional.

Night Vision: A camera that works great in daylight is useless at night. That's why we prioritize models with Sony or Starlight sensors, which capture more light and produce clearer images in low-light conditions. The VM-708-C22 kit, for example, uses a Sony sensor that turns night into day—critical for drivers making early-morning or late-night deliveries.

Durability: Truck cameras live in a tough neighborhood. They're exposed to vibrations from bumpy roads, extreme temperatures (from -40°C to 80°C in some cases), and occasional impacts from debris. That's why we prefer metal housings for heavy-duty models and shatterproof lenses—so your investment lasts longer than a single road trip.
